XERCISE 2 Circulatory system

Social Studies
1 answer:
Veseljchak [2.6K]3 years ago
3 0

Answer:

1. oxygen and nutrients - blood carries oxygen and nutrients and transports it to the cells located in different parts of the body.

2. After transporting the oxygen and nutrients to the cell blood picks the carbon dioxide gas from the cell that is produced by the cellular respiration and transports it to the lungs to breathe out from the body.

3. Veins are the blood vessels that carry blood towards the heart from the various part of the body it carries deoxygenated blood.

4. Arteries are the blood vessels that carry oxygenated or oxygen-rich blood away from the heart to the different parts of the body.

5. Capillaries are the smallest blood vessels that get blood from the arterioles and are can be seen only under the microscope.

The list of main components of the circulatory system are :

Heart - that pumps or pushes blood throughout the body of the organism.

Blood - medium of transporting the oxygen and nutrients and have cells with different functions.

Blood vessels - are the tiny tube-like structures that carry blood to and from the heart.

The main function of the circulatory system is to transport oxygen and nutrients to provide the cells fuel for their cellar functions by performing cellular respiration.
